The Squeezelark endpoint handles telemetry payload compression for every release channel. Post your raw payload to `/v2/compress` and you'll get back a zstd-wrapped blob plus a ratio header, handy for spotting bloated builds before you ship. As release manager, you'll mostly care about the batch mode, which accepts up to 500 payloads per call. All requests need authentication against the internal Squeezelark gateway, and the key you should configure in your pipeline is shown below.

gateway credential: kto23_LX9A4ys6i4nzHtpOLNLodKK

- [ ] **Step 7: Breaker override escrow.** After sealing the signing keys for the Tallgrove upstream API circuit breaker, confirm the support team can force the breaker open during a full outage. The override bundle lives in the sealed escrow drawer and is useless without its unlock phrase. Two ceremony witnesses must initial this step before proceeding. The escrow bundle is decrypted with the recovery passphrase that follows.

vault phrase of kahip-kahop = holath-quenmir

Handover: Crashfunnel pipeline (from Dara to Olen). Plugin authors should know that crash reports from the Pebblework mobile app land in the ingest queue, get symbolicated, then fan out to registered plugins. Retries are capped at three; anything beyond that goes to the dead-letter topic. Plugins must stay idempotent. The values your plugin needs to connect are listed below.

service settings:
PRAIX_LOG_LEVEL=error
PRAIX_METRICS_HOST=metrics.praix.qorvelcorp.corp
PRAIX_POOL_SIZE=16

### Audit Item 14 — Recipe Scaler Rounding

Give the PortionPal scaling calculator a once-over: confirm fractional conversions round sanely (no one wants 0.33 eggs), that unit swaps between metric and imperial are covered by tests, and that the max-batch cap actually blocks absurd inputs. Note anything weird in the findings sheet. Questions go straight to the feature's accountable owner.

named custodian: Belius Casath Ulaix Sorius

## Signing scanner builds

Every build of the Tillhook barcode scanner plugin gets signed before it ships — the handheld firmware flat-out refuses unsigned bundles, so don't skip it. Signing happens in CI automatically, but for local test flashes you'll need to sign by hand. The key you want is right here.

signing key of bagap-yawep = bky13_TbfT6ZMUoGJo2